数据库编码是一个很重要的问题, 推荐网页和数据库都用utf8编码, utf8编码, 对于英文和ansi是一样的, 效率非常高, 但是对于中文, 每个字符占3个字节, 效率会变低, 但是, 这种编码使用广泛, 相对于致命的乱码问题, 考虑到优化和压缩, 存储和传输的效率影响也不是很大.
mysql数据库的默认编码是Latin, 好像是瑞典语, 而不是国际化标准的utf8, 但是我们会发现, 即使这样
转载
2023-09-12 10:14:40
116阅读
# MySQL修改表的编码格式
MySQL是一个广泛使用的开源关系型数据库管理系统,它支持多种编码格式。在某些情况下,需要修改表的编码格式以适应特定的需求或问题。本文将介绍如何使用MySQL命令行工具和SQL语句来修改表的编码格式,并提供相关的代码示例。
## 什么是编码格式?
编码格式是用来表示和存储字符的方式。在数据库中,每个字符都使用一组二进制数进行存储和传输。不同的编码格式使用不同的
# MySQL 显示表编码格式
在MySQL数据库中,字符集(Charset)和排序规则(Collation)是非常重要的概念,它们决定了存储在数据库中的文本数据的编码格式和排序方式。在实际开发中,我们经常需要查询数据库中表的编码格式,以确保数据的一致性和正确性。下面将介绍如何在MySQL中显示表的编码格式。
## 显示表编码格式
要显示MySQL数据库中表的编码格式,可以通过如下SQL语句
## MySQL创建表以及编码格式
作为一名经验丰富的开发者,我将指导你如何在MySQL中创建表以及设置编码格式。在开始之前,我们先来了解整个过程的流程。
### 创建表的流程
1. 连接到MySQL数据库。
2. 创建一个数据库(如果不存在)。
3. 选择要使用的数据库。
4. 创建表并定义表的结构。
5. 设置表的编码格式。
现在,让我们逐步了解每个步骤需要做什么,并给出相应的代码和注
# MySQL统一库里的表编码格式
MySQL是一种常用的关系型数据库管理系统,用于存储和管理大量的数据。在MySQL中,我们可以通过创建表来组织和管理数据。而在创建表时,一个重要的要考虑因素就是表的编码格式。本文将介绍MySQL统一库里的表编码格式,并提供相应的代码示例。
## 什么是表编码格式?
表编码格式指的是表中存储的数据的字符编码方式。在MySQL中,常见的编码格式有UTF-8、G
原创
2023-08-25 18:31:26
136阅读
# 如何查看MySQL表中某字段的编码格式
## 一、流程步骤
| 步骤 | 操作 |
| ------ | ------ |
| 1 | 登录MySQL数据库 |
| 2 | 选择要查看的数据库 |
| 3 | 查看表结构并找到目标字段 |
| 4 | 查看字段的编码格式 |
## 二、具体操作
### 1. 登录MySQL数据库
首先,打开命令行工具或者MySQL客户端,输入以下命令
TextFileHive数据表的默认格式,存储方式:行存储。可使用Gzip,Bzip2等压缩算法压缩,压缩后的文件不支持split但在反序列化过程中,必须逐个字符判断是不是分隔符和行结束符,因此反序列化开销会比SequenceFile高几十倍。--创建数据表:
create table if not exists textfile_table(
site string,
url string,
转载
2023-08-04 11:09:04
352阅读
首先第一张表还是我们单表查询之前用到t_employee,我们在另外新建一个表t_dept(部门表)建表命令如下: drop table if exists t_dept;
CREATE TABLE t_dept (
_id INT PRIMARY KEY,
deptno INT(11),
dname VARCHAR(20),
loc VARCHAR(50)
);
概念:类似于java的方法,将一组逻辑语句封装在方法体中,对外暴露方法名好处:1、隐藏了实现细节 2、提高代码的重用性调用:select 函数名(实参列表) 【from 表】;特点: ①叫什么(函数名) ②干什么(函数功能)分类: 1、单行函数 如 concat、length、ifnull等 2、分组函数 功能:做统计使用,又称为统计函数、聚合函数、组函数常见函数: 一、单行函数 字符函数:le
转载
2023-06-22 23:09:37
138阅读
登录 - MySQL内部
mysql -u root -p
MySQL内部 - 查看数据库编码格式 (推荐用这个,我用的这个!)
show variables like 'character%';
MySQL内部 - 查看数据库编码格式 (这两个都可以查看数据库编码格式)
show variables like ‘collation%’;按照上面两步我们会输出下面:mysql> show
## MySQL导出表指定编码格式流程
下面是MySQL导出表指定编码格式的流程图:
```mermaid
flowchart TD
start(开始)
step1(连接数据库)
step2(导出表)
step3(指定编码格式)
end(结束)
start --> step1 --> step2 --> step3 --> end
```
#
## MySQL创建表时如何设置编码格式
在MySQL数据库中,当我们创建表时,可以设置表的编码格式,以确保数据库中的数据可以正确存储和检索。在本文中,我们将讨论如何在MySQL创建表时设置编码格式,并提供一个实际问题的解决方案。
### 实际问题
假设我们有一个名为`users`的表,其中包含用户的姓名和电子邮件地址。我们希望确保这些数据以正确的编码格式存储在数据库中,以避免出现乱码或其他
# MySQL编码格式详解
MySQL是一种流行的关系型数据库管理系统,支持多种编码格式。在实际开发中,选择合适的编码格式非常重要,可以避免乱吗显示、存储数据错误等问题。本文将介绍MySQL的编码格式,包括常见的编码格式、设置编码格式的方法以及常见问题解决方案。
## MySQL常见编码格式
MySQL支持多种编码格式,常见的编码格式包括:
1. **UTF-8**:最常用的编码格式,支持
请注意,对于已有的数据,修改编码格式可能会导致数据的转换和重新排序,可能会影响数据的完整性和查询结果。在进行编码格式
# Hive表查看编码格式
在Hive中,表是数据的逻辑组织单位,它可以存储结构化数据,并提供SQL查询功能。当我们在使用Hive时,有时需要查看表的编码格式,以确保数据的正确性和一致性。本文将介绍如何在Hive中查看表的编码格式,并给出相应的代码示例。
## 什么是编码格式
编码格式是指将数据转换为特定编码规则的过程,例如UTF-8、GBK等。不同的编码格式对应不同的字符集和字符编码方式。
Windows、Linux系统下mysql编码设置方法1怎样手工修改mysql4.1以上版本默认编码使用php5+MySQL 4.1.x/5.x 环境:mysql4导入mysql5容易出现中文乱码情况,因此,首先你需要做如下设置:这里假设mysql是装在c:\mysql目录下1: 开始-运行,输入cmd 按回车键2:输入cd c:\mysql\bin 按回车键3:输入mysql --default
## 查看Hive表编码格式
在Hive中,表的编码格式对于数据的存储和查询都有一定的影响。编码格式可以影响数据的压缩率、查询性能等方面。因此,了解表的编码格式是进行性能调优的重要一环。
### 查看表的编码格式
要查看Hive表的编码格式,可以使用以下命令:
```markdown
SHOW CREATE TABLE table_name;
```
这个命令会显示表的创建语句,其中包括
MySQL的默认编码是Latin1,不支持中文,要支持中文需要把数据库的默认编码修改为gbk或者utf8。1、需要以root用户身份登陆才可以查看数据库编码方式(以root用户身份登陆的命令为:
[root@localhost bin]# mysql -u root -p
Enter password:
Welcome to the MySQL monitor. Commands end wi
## Hive建表编码格式的实现步骤
为了实现Hive建表编码格式,我们需要按照以下步骤进行操作:
步骤 | 操作
------------ | -------------
1 | 登录到Hive客户端
2 | 创建一个数据库
3 | 切换到所创建的数据库
4 | 创建一个表
5 | 指定表的字段和数据类型,并设置编码格式
下面我们逐步详细介绍每个步骤的具体操作及相应的代码。
### 步骤
# 项目方案:怎么查看Hbase表的编码格式
## 1. 项目背景
在Hbase中,表的编码格式对于数据的存储和处理有着重要作用。因此,了解Hbase表的编码格式对于数据管理和优化十分重要。本项目旨在提供一种简单的方法来查看Hbase表的编码格式,帮助用户更好地理解表的存储结构。
## 2. 解决方案
为了查看Hbase表的编码格式,我们可以通过Hbase Shell工具来获取表的详细信息。以